Gly-Pro-AMC
CAS 115035-46-6
Gly-Pro-AMC is a sensitive fluorogenic substrate for detecting dipeptidyl peptidase IV (DPPIV), a serine protease that cleaves N-terminal dipeptides from polypeptides with L-proline or L-alanine at the penultimate position. DPPIV is a multifunctional protein expressed on the surface of several cell types including epithelial, endothelial and lymphoid cells. It is identical to the T cell activation antigen CD26 and the adenosine deaminase binding protein, and it is also released as a soluble form in plasma. The substrates of CD26/DPPIV include a wide variety of proline-containing peptides such as growth factors, chemokines, neuropeptides, and vasoactive peptides. DPPIV is involved in immune regulation, signal transduction, and apoptosis, and appears to play an important role in tumor progression. Importantly, DPPIV is a therapeutic target for type II diabetes due to its role as a serum protease that cleaves incretin hormones of the glucagon family of peptides and thus regulates glucose homeostasis. Studies indicate that a DPPIV inhibitor improves impaired glucose tolerance. The assay of DPPIV with Gly-Pro-AMC is a simple, fast and flexible assay that is ideal for high-through put screening. The assay demonstrates improved sensitivity compared to colorimetric DPPIV assays, allowing the researcher to use less enzyme while still achieving appropriate Z' values. The homogeneous coupled-enzyme format is convenient, requiring only a single reagent addition to the test samples. Maximal sensitivity is achieved in 20-30 minutes, and the signal generated is very stable.
